<p><b>John 8:36</b> &ndash; So if the Son sets you free, you will be free indeed. (NIV)</p>
<p>&quot;We&#39;re emancipated; we&#39;re liberated; we&#39;re in control, don&#39;t worry.&quot; These confident utterances are arising from young adolescent girls trying to console worried adults, according to a <i>Maclean&#39;s</i> magazine article, &quot;Outraged Moms, Trashy Daughters&quot; (August 16, 2010). The article expresses a growing concern over girls &quot;being groomed to believe their purpose in life is to be sexual beings that please men&quot;. These girls believe that they can use their bodies to hold power over the boys; but they cannot see that they are being exploited by male-dominated industries and seduced through the sexualization of culture. <i>Maclean&#39;s</i> asks, &quot;How did those steeped in the women&#39;s lib movement produce girls who think being a sex object is powerful?&quot; Perhaps we should ask: how did freedom become so enslaving?</p>
<p>Jesus saw that happening in His day. When He told some people, &quot;The truth will set you free&quot; <i>(John 8:32b NIV)</i>, they were offended by His insinuation that they were slaves. They saw themselves as free, but they were thinking politically, not spiritually. Jesus saw them as slaves to a sinful nature, and He alone could free them. The &quot;truth&quot; that Jesus offered would not give one freedom to choose from an unrestricted set of options. That in itself is debilitating &mdash; which today&#39;s 20- to 30-year-olds are discovering: this age group faces so many options that they don&#39;t know what to decide. Many of them are putting off decisions needed to launch them into full adulthood. They are labelled as the &quot;failure to launch&quot; generation. This may very well reflect our many societal freedoms &mdash; but freedom in Christ is different.</p>
<p>Christ&#39;s &quot;truth&quot; narrows down our priorities. It is intended to preserve spiritual freedom:</p>
<p><b>Romans 6:18</b> &ndash; You have been set free from sin and have become slaves to righteousness. (NIV)</p>
<p>Really, it&#39;s about freedom to belong to God and become effective members of God&#39;s kingdom &mdash; unshackled from anything which hinders our calling. This freedom is not limited by one&#39;s lot in life:</p>
<p><b>1 Corinthians 7:22</b> &ndash; For the one who was a slave when called to faith in the Lord is the Lord&#39;s freed person; similarly, the one who was free when called is Christ&#39;s slave. (NIV 2011)</p>
<p>Freedom in Christ, then, is a gift and power within which no circumstance, ruling power, or enticing lure can either give us or rob from us. That is being free indeed!</p>
<p><b>Prayer:</b> Lord, we pray that Your Spirit will move amongst the young people in our society &mdash; and indeed, among us all &mdash; that many will come to see the emptiness of their pursuits, and hunger for the true freedom that can come only from Christ. Amen.</p>
